The Now Zealand Express Company's Argyll motor lorry has now covered nearly 25,000 miles in two years' service without any breakdown. It lias made frequent lonjj journeys up country, sometimes of between 200 and 300 miles in the round trip, carrying full loads nil the time, anil crossing the Paekakariki and Riimitaka saddles. Argylls aro adopted by tho principal municipalities and motor transport companies in New Zealand. For immediate delivery ono 1-ton Argyll commercial vehicle. J. E.
